Work in an environment that combines the creativity of a scale-up with the expertise of an enterprise.
Join a dynamic team as a talented and driven Backend Engineer.
Collaborate with cross-functional teams and contribute to meaningful projects.
Responsibilities include Python microservices development, upgrading and developing the analytics platform, optimizing data platforms, and researching solutions to suggest improvements to the overall user experience.
Requirements:
A Bachelor's degree in Computer Science, Engineering, or a related field is required.
Proven experience as a Backend Engineer or in a similar software development role is necessary.
Strong proficiency in Python is essential.
In-depth knowledge of Docker is required.
Advanced working knowledge of various databases and data-intensive applications is necessary.
Strong experience with ETL and data processing is required.
Basic knowledge of CI/CD practices is necessary.
Experience with distributed systems design and the microservices paradigm is required.
Good knowledge of REST frameworks like FastAPI is a plus.
Familiarity with Java and Node.js is a plus.
Experience with pipeline tools like Airflow is a plus.
Candidates should be passionate about the digital world, enthusiastic, curious, and talented problem solvers.
Excellent communication and relational skills are required.
Ability to work both independently and as part of a team is necessary.
Proficiency in English is required as the team is international.
Benefits:
Learning Fridays are provided, allowing team members to utilize a training budget for books, online courses, or other training materials.
Smart Working options are available, enabling employees to work from home and save commuting time.
A competitive salary based on experience, supplemented with additional bonuses, is offered.
The typical salary for this role ranges between €35,000 and €60,000, with compensation reviews based on experience and contributions to the business.
Opportunities to receive company equity are available.